Summary

Roman coins have been found in the parish, although their exact findspot is not known.

Pre 1980.
House at 377 012.
Exact findspot not known, could be site NHER 4233.
5 coins, one being a sestertius probably struck by Hadrian AD 117 to 138.
Identified by A. Gregory (NAU) 1980.
